Abstract: | This paper investigates co-operative strategies in a sample of pharmaceutical and scientific instrument companies. Internationalisation strategies depend on the company's overall strategy, the context of the firm and it's past history of internationalisation. A single internationalisation strategy cannot be described and that for the firm as a whole, conflicting international moves are often made, because many internationalisation moves are shown to be initiated at unit, division, site or individual manager level. |
